Output 124b64390c18b21a9aad57f050303ba2a91b5aaa8c6373ac225c6ca9a1f2e1ac:0

value
1190552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ad4dd05908391586dd702db4c89f2aafff462e0 OP_EQUAL
address
MTrEYFkhaPSJq35ASHSWB3QLwdgptSFmi7
transaction
124b64390c18b21a9aad57f050303ba2a91b5aaa8c6373ac225c6ca9a1f2e1ac
spent
true